  1. About three miles from Ballylanders in (in County Limerick) Leaba Molaga is situated, where St Molaga is supposed to be buried.
    About five miles North East of this there are old ruins of a monastery. * A vault supposed to be the Saints resting place is there also. It has an opening or a space which would a person and anyone suffering from any disease is supposed to be cured if he goes in and lies down in this !!!
    This too is a graveyard.
    The above was related to me by a woman.
    Mary Mounce
    College Road,
    Fermoy.
    *Near the above mentioned place there were four pillars standing in the shape of a square (one of them has fallen and is now sunk into the ground) these were supposed to be four robbers who turned into pillars when they were caught. My grandmother saw lights coming out of these pillars.
    Mary Mounce
